Salted Fish
Posted on | November 6, 2008 | 1 Comment
Salted fish can be commonly found in many shops that sell preserved seafood & herbs.
Salted fish is mainly consumed by the Southern Chinese and is a very common dish among the elderly in Hong Kong. The younger generations are not so keen on this as there are many cases of cancer (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ma - cancer of nose & throat) that are closely related to consumption of salted fish.
Salted fish is commonly found in the fried rice in Hong Kong. It is added to give an extra boost of fragrance to the ordinary plain fried rice. This dish can be ordered in many local coffee houses during lunch hour.
